About The Role
We’re looking for an Client Executive/Producer to join our award-winning Business Insurance division for our Western Canadian clients. The successful applicant will leverage their industry knowledge & experience to initiate and develop new commercial lines relationships for Mid-Market Business.
What You’ll Do
- Proactively identify new business opportunities and build relationships with quality commercial lines business leads via referrals and other prospecting techniques
- Develop submissions (in conjunction with commercial lines underwriting staff) to markets that will meet present/emerging needs of the client and close the sale
- Quote between 1-5 mid to large prospects per month, or as needed to meet production plan following all quality control and underwriting procedures established by NFP
- Hand-off responsibility for provision of service to clients to the relevant Account Manager in the service teams
- When appropriate to the maintenance of good customer service, field customer service requests (especially post-sale of one’s clients), and ensure the completion by oneself, or by referral to the service Account Manager
